Anyway, back to the original topic...Everyone always says that adding pH Down to tap (or any other water that is buffered) will be futile because it will simply be fighting the buffering capacity and the pH will eventually bounce back up. I understand this. So my question is, if I mix my tap with R.O. and THEN use the pH Down, won't it work much better (won't bounce back up) because I have cut down on my hardness by mixing with R.O.? Will the pH Down use up ALL of my remaining KH?
 
For anyone interested, this is what I've been doing...I have been mixing 3 gallons of tap with 2 gallons of R.O. After I aerate the mixture, my pH ends up around 7.4-7.6. I then add 8-10 drops of a pH Down product, which brings my pH to a 7 (where I want to be). My problem as of this moment is that I am out of my KH test kit. Usually when I mix 3 gallons of tap with 2 gallons R.O., my KH is around 3-4 degrees. When I drop my pH to a 7 with the ph Down, how much KH do you think it uses to get there? Anyone? Anyone? :)
